chef 3745 Posted October 13, 2021 Share Posted October 13, 2021 (edited) On 9/24/2021 at 4:07 AM, JLEH0590 said: I must say, this is an extremely useful plugin. Thanks a lot @chef! I did have issue with inputs from subbed anime releases, but what I did was stage the files and rename prior to injecting them into the watch folders. The issue being that the metadata search was not finding any relevant results. I'm not too sure how it internally handles my input. Giving it a more meaningful format and removing some texts clarifies it for the search to work. However, the unedited files still work when just placed inside Emby's media library folder. This got my head scratching a bit. For anyone who may be interested on how: Use the rename (PERL rename) utility on linux that uses a RegEx substitution syntax with the following RegEx: rename 's/(\[\w*\])\s([\w\D]*)\s(\d+)\s\(\d+p\)\s\[\w*\](\.mkv)/$2 S1E$3$4/' * This is valid for the following name strings with the caveat of replacing the Season identifier at the end with the appropriate Season number (.e.g. S1 for Season and S2 for season 2): For the last one you'd want to change the RegEx as follows: rename 's/(\[\w*\])\s([\w\D]*)\s(S\d+)\D+(\d+)\s\(\d+p\)\s\[\w*\](\.mkv)/$2 $3E$4$5/' * For anyone wanting to use these, add the -n flag to test it out first. After which, I just let Emby do the minutiae of managing the files in bulk. This is a very similar regex to what the plugin uses. chef 3745 Posted October 13, 2021 Share Posted October 13, 2021 Really quickly regarding subtitle files. Right now we check the size of a file to decide weather or not not bother with it. We use naming conventions as well, but that's off point. Inorder to sort sub title files we'll have to check the extension and override the file size condition. The question is: do you want subtitles listed in the activity log, or is it better to have an options in the movie/episode config page that just says: "move subtitle files if found"? I think that by putting them in the activity page it will get crowed, however I'm game for anything 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
